Output 31736fbaea32c7a796b88095b6350736d9dee8bafcb8fc2b963864a9641240fd:15

value
30690590
script pubkey
OP_0 OP_PUSHBYTES_32 dd26869390abc7f6e76393c3cb135a5c605f20bf297db84597a30f87c0f9c39d
address
bc1qm5ngdyus40rldemrj0puky66t3s97g9l997ms3vh5v8c0s8ecwwsj2l3xz
transaction
31736fbaea32c7a796b88095b6350736d9dee8bafcb8fc2b963864a9641240fd
confirmations
176046
spent
true